Woodstock Sterile Solutions (WSS) is the leading North American blow-fill-seal (BFS) sterile contract development and manufacturing organization (CDMO). From our 430,000 sq ft advanced aseptic manufacturing facility in Woodstock, Illinois, we leverage 50+ years of BFS technology leadership and our patented cold BFS process to serve clients across ophthalmics, respiratory, biologics, and diagnostics markets. We are committed to Proven Excellence. Trusted Solutions.
This is an entry-level opportunity to build a career in advanced aseptic BFS manufacturing. The BFS Technician Level 0 learns basic BFS theory, personal protective equipment (PPE) use, tool handling, and core processes such as BFS start-up, machine and tank sterilization, filter integrity testing, temperature recorder function, set-up drawing interpretation, and batch record documentation. This role requires aseptic gowning certification as a prerequisite to entering the Aseptic BFS Suite. This position is a growth pathway — upon completing training and qualification, employees advance to BFS Technician Level 1.
